Spotlight Asia Case Study : “ALL OF A SUDDEN” by Ryusuke Hamaguchi

This case study examines how Ryūsuke Hamaguchi’s ALL OF A SUDDEN leverages auteur prestige to secure a four-country co-production (France, Japan, Germany, Belgium). Led by a French producer and backed by European public funding, the project illustrates a director-driven model that bridges Japanese talent with European financing and global distribution.

JAPAN PITCH presented by ATMOVIE GLOBAL TRACK

JAPAN PITCH is an official pitch event showcasing five fellows selected from ATMOVIE GLOBAL TRACK, an accelerator program dedicated to launching the next generation of Japanese filmmakers onto the global stage. Presented in English by the creators themselves, these pitches feature unique narratives and business plans meticulously polished to international standards. JAPAN PITCH serves as a "platform for co-creation," connecting global producers, investors, and sales agents interested in Japanese co-productions to propel these projects into their next phase.

The IMAGICA GROUP Film Project – Second Edition Press Conference

IMAGICA GROUP will announce the selection results for the second edition of the “IMAGICA GROUP Film Project” at the 79th Cannes Film Festival. The project was launched in 2025 to nurture and discover new talent and to explore the potential of Japanese visual expression on a global stage. Kei Ishikawa (film director), Shozo Ichiyama (Programming Director of the Tokyo International Film Festival), and Yuka Sakano (Executive Director of the Kawakita Memorial Film Institute) served as jury members for the selection. This announcement forms part of the official program of Cannes 2026 – Marché du Film, in collaboration with the Country of Honour Executive Committee.

International
Co-production Subsidy

Agency for Cultural Affairs, Government of Japan (Bunka-cho) supports international film co-productions to promote cultural exchange through cinema, and contribute to the development of Japanese film.

Subsidy Amount:

・Twenty(20) % of the eligible production costs within the out-of-pocket costs of the Japanese corporations/entities and the cost that incurred by the Japanese corporations/entities during the relevant fiscal year.

・A CAP of JPY 50M for the Work with eligible production costs between JPY100M to JPY300M. A CAP of JPY 100M for the Work with eligible production costs greater than 300M.
